Turmeric Ginger Cinnamon Tea

Turmeric Ginger Cinnamon Tea - soothing and refreshing, tea that helps to fight cold, flu and aids in digestion. Although this caffeine-free tea can be enjoyed all year round, it is especially perfect to keep you warm in winters.

Ingredients

1 Cup = 250ml ; 1 Tablespoon = 15ml ; 1 Teaspoon = 5ml

  • 2 cups (or) 500 ml Water
  • 1 Teaspoon Turmeric Powder
  • 1 inch (or) 1 Tablespoon Ginger peeled and grated
  • 1 stick (or) 4 inches Cinnamon
  • 1 Tablespoon Lemon Juice adjust to taste
  • 1 Teaspoon Honey adjust to suit your taste

Instructions

  • Combine cinnamon, turmeric, ginger, water in a saucepan, and bring the mixture to boil on medium-high heat.
    2 cups (or) 500 ml Water, 1 Teaspoon Turmeric Powder, 1 inch (or) 1 Tablespoon Ginger, 1 stick (or) 4 inches Cinnamon
  • Reduce the heat and simmer for about 10 minutes
  • Turn off the heat, mix in lime juice and honey.
    1 Tablespoon Lemon Juice, 1 Teaspoon Honey
  • Strain the tea through a fine strainer to remove the spices and divide between 2 cups.
  • Enjoy hot and spicy turmeric ginger cinnamon tea.

Notes

You may substitute ground turmeric with fresh turmeric root. Grate it and use along with other spices.
You can substitute freshly grated ginger with ½ teaspoon ground ginger. Fresh ginger imparts subtle flavour than ground ginger.
Fresh cinnamon may be substituted with ¼ teaspoon ground cinnamon.
The Alternate method of making this herbal tea is to steep all the spices in a heat resistant pitcher/teapot and mix in lemon juice and honey just before enjoying. Steeping time depends on how strong you want your tea to be. Longer the spices are steeped, stronger the tea would be.
Adjust spices and honey as per your taste preference. Do you feel the tea is too spicy? cut down ginger. Is it too sweet? cut down honey. Cut down turmeric if you feel its too strong.
For a vegan version, swap in maple syrup, agave or any healthy plant-based sweetener for honey.
